Connecting to the Backbone Using the AUI Port
Connecting
Other Devices
The RJ45B Module provides two types of connectors for attaching
devices:
❏
AUI connectors for connecting to the backbone
and to other hubs. One of the connectors accom-
modates a recessed Mini MAU.
❏
RJ45 connectors (24 10BaseT ports) for attaching
to network devices
Connecting to the
Backbone Using the
AUI Port
You have two AUI connectors on the front panel—a recessed and
a non-recessed connector. The recessed AUI connector is designed
to accommodate an Asanté Mini MAU.
To connect the hub to the backbone, use one of the AUI connec-
tors. Use a MAU if your backbone is Thin, Fiber, or Twisted-Pair.
∆
Note: Make sure SQE (Signal Quality Error) is dis-
abled on the MAU when it is attached to the AUI
connector.
In Figure 6, the hub is connected to a Fiber backbone using an
Asanté 10BaseF Mini MAU in the recessed AUI connector.
